If you select the Toll Saver option in the configuration dialog box, Toll Saver will be applied to all outgoing ISDN calls. You must disable the Toll Saver feature to place calls to devices that do not support this feature.

11.To change the B channel data rate, select either 56, 64, or Toll Saver for the B Channel Rate. For more information about Toll Saver, see the “Placing a Toll Saver call” section on page 6-8.

Multilink PPP allows a maximum digital connection of up to 128 Kbps by virtually linking two 56 Kbps or 64 Kbps B channels.

12.Click in the Multilink check box in the PPP area (lower-right cor- ner) to toggle Multilink PPP. If the box is checked, Multilink PPP is on. For more information about Multilink PPP, see the “Using Multilink PPP” section on page 6-4.

13.Click the Update button to download the parameters displayed in the dialog box to your ISDN modem.

14.Check the status area to verify the configuration. If the parame- ters were configured accurately and the ISDN modem is ready to send and receive calls, the status area fields should contain the information shown below. Note that you do not configure the Terminal Endpoint Identifier (TEI) numbers, they are gener- ated automatically by the telephone company.

Layer 1: UP

SPID 1: Init

TEI 1: Number from 0 to 127

SPID 2: Init (if required)

TEI 2: Number from 0 to 127 (if required)
